Output 15b1bfcba78116d68836ed00ac28534d71c776d0df2b68fb938915f70804d810:4

value
32494279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da145f9e26cadaec8b32ca766efd3cf052a9bedf OP_EQUAL
address
MTnFwppZRhFE7eAfb62bjcyYZMN2rnDzeH
transaction
15b1bfcba78116d68836ed00ac28534d71c776d0df2b68fb938915f70804d810
spent
true